LADIES ALWAYS SHOOT FIRST A lady in love keeps a loaded pistol. CAPTURED BY A DUKE Freedom is within her grasp... if she truly desires escape. When Lady Annabel sets out to introduce herself to her fiancé the day before their wedding, she doesn't count on being waylaid by highwaymen. Kidnapped, but not without recourse, Annabel shoots her abductor and escapes. Too late, she discovers she might not want her freedom. TO SAVE A LORD A woman in love will risk anything for true love's kiss. Kitty Brightly's reputation is in tatters, and not even her friend the Duchess of Southwood's influence is enough to invite suitors. When, at long last, one appears where Kitty least expects him, her boldness threatens to ruin everything. Yet, that same boldness might be the one thing that saves them both. ONE SHOT FOR A GENTLEMEN What's a woman to do when love turns into double the trouble? After a night of romance and a declaration of love, Dalilah Cartwell is devastated to learn that her best friend, Lydia, is engaged to the same gentleman who wooed her. Dissuading their brothers' attempts to defend their honor, the two meet the rogue at dawn, only to discover that trouble comes in twos. ANYTHING FOR A LORD Some mysteries are better left unsolved. Free, at last, after the death of her controlling father, Victoria Kirkland must immediately find a husband or risk a forced marriage to her cousin. When he tries to compromise her, she turns to a brave, handsome stranger for help. Discovering a love so strong she doesn't care to ask questions, she eagerly weds her savior, but soon learns that some mysteries are better off solved before you say I do.

Summer Hanford grew up on a dairy farm in Upstate New York. She earned her bachelor’s degree in experimental psychology and went on to do graduate and doctoral work in behavioral neurology. Eventually turning away from long hours spent in research, Summer returned to her childhood dream of being an author. Summer writes in three genres; Epic Fantasy, Historical Romance, and Pride & Prejudice Variations. Summer’s complete five novel YA fantasy series, Thrice Born, was published by Martin Sisters Publishing and is available wherever books are sold. Starting in 2014, Summer was offered the privilege of partnering with fan fiction author Renata McMann on her well-loved Pride and Prejudice variations. Since then, they’ve had over a dozen amazon number one best sellers, in the US and several other countries, in both Europe and Latin America. In 2020, Summer launched her Crown & Dagger Historical Romance Series and in 2021, she launched her new Epic Fantasy Series, Rise of the Summer God.
